A conventional activated-sludge treatment plant with effluent chlorination consistently produces a treated wastewater with a BOD less than 20 mg/l, suspended solids less than 30 mg/l, and fecal coliform count less than 200 organisms per 100 ml. The effluent has been described by the plant superintendent as clear “sparkling” water. You have been asked to evaluate the feasibility of using the effluent to irrigate the city’s public park, which has playgrounds, and to apply to the state department of environmental control for permission to reuse the wastewater for this application. To introduce the idea and to allay the fears of an environmental citizens group, you have been asked to present a preliminary assessment of the situation to the city council. Outline the subjects that you would discuss in your presentation. (Refer to Sections 8.1,11.31, and 11.32).
